So what got thrown away?

1. Prescription drug pricing that would save consumers Hundreds of Billions of Dollars ➡️ Gone

2. Adding comprehensive Vision, Dental & Hearing coverage to Medicare ➡️ Gone

3. Climate provision that would vigorously force utilities to switch to clean energy ➡️ Gone

4. Federal program to provide 12 Weeks of Paid Family & Medical Leave ➡️ Gone

5. Significant Tax hikes on Corporations & the Wealthy ➡️ Gone
